Peace, food security, and development are intricately linked in Africa's journey towards a prosperous future. Sayon Doumbouya from Gamal Abdel Nasser University of Conakry in Guinea emphasizes the critical connection between these elements.
Doumbouya highlights that sustainable development in Africa cannot be achieved without ensuring peace and food security. By fostering collaboration with the Chinese mainland, African nations can effectively address challenges such as agricultural productivity, infrastructure development, and economic stability.
This partnership aims to implement innovative solutions and leverage resources to enhance food production and distribution, thereby mitigating hunger and enhancing quality of life. Through such collaborative efforts, Africa is poised to build a resilient and thriving future.
